Hey ladies. You both did great workouts. Today I did Drill Max (cardio only) and my diet is getting better every day. I did some research online about low glycemic foods. I found very interesting information and I've been doing some changes in my food choices. So far that feeling of hunger one hour after I've eaten is almost completely gone. I know it's taking my body a couple of days to adjust, but the changes were so simple. Like for example I would normally eat 4 onz yogurt with a cookie as a snack for a total of around 100-125 cals, but the cookie is high glycemic so that means that 60-90mins later I was starving and I would eat everything in sight good or bad. Now I substitute the cookie for half an apple (40 cals) and I cut it into tiny pieces and I add it to the yogurt (60 cals) and I have a snack that's 100 cals and low glycemic. When it comes time to eat my next meal I'm not starving to death, I'm just normally hungry and I can wait to prepare my next healthy meal. I don't know if I'm losing weight or not, but I know that I feel less tired.
